theknowledgeonline: Life is Goode for Matthew

Actor Matthew Goode (A Single Man, Watchmen) has been working pretty much non-stop recently, with plenty lined up for the near future too. From working with Benedict Cumberbatch to being stuck in a diving bell at the bottom of the sea, here, just for Goode measure, is our round up of his current projects – with further information on many of them on Production Intelligence.

He is currently shooting his role of Hugh Alexander in The Imitation Game, which stars Benedict Cumberbatch as the brilliant mathematician Alan Turing, whose work at Bletchley Park during World War II helped crack the Germans’ Enigma code. Directed by Morten Tyldum, the feature co-stars Keira Knightley, Mark Strong, Rory Kinnear and Charles Dance.

Goode will then head to the US to film Selfless with Ryan Reynolds, Natalie Martinez and Ben Kingsley. The feature is directed by Tarsem Singh, and centres on the idea of mind transference and what happens when a dying elderly man inhabits a younger body, that of a murder victim.

Matthew Goode landscape

And it is hoped that there will be room in his schedule to film Destroyer, a forthcoming feature from Warp Films about the warship HMS Coventry which was sunk during the Falklands War. At the moment, locations are yet to be tied down, but we are told it’s a project which definitely has Goode’s interest.

He recently finished filming Ron Scalpello’s Pressure, with Danny Huston and Joe Cole about four deep sea divers who become trapped at the bottom of the ocean. It was filmed at Pinewood and in Scotland.

One of the most anticipated British films this year is Belle, in which Goode plays Captain Sir John Lindsay. The feature, directed by Amma Asante, is based on the real life story of Dido Elizabeth Belle, the first mixed race woman to appear in the higher echelons of London society in the 18th century. Gugu Mbatha Raw stars in the title role, with Tom Wilkinson, Miranda Richardson and Emily Watson among the robust cast. The film was shot on some beautiful locations in London and the Isle of Man – you can read more from the location managers themselves over on our sister website, KFTV.

And you only have to wait until Christmas for a Goode drama, as the BBC will be airing Death Comes to Pemberley as part of the festive schedule. Filmed over the summer in Leeds, the Pride and Prejudice follow-up is based on the P.D James novel which revisits the Darcys’ marriage six years on, as a body is found in the grounds of Pemberley. Goode plays Wickham in the three-parter, with Anna Maxwell Martin as Elizabeth and Matthew Rhys as Darcy. Juliette Towhidi has written the screenplay.

THR: Matthew Goode, Mark Strong and Rory Kinnear Join Cast of ‘The Imitation Game’

Benedict Cumberbatch and Keira Knightley also star in director Morten Tyldum’s film about the English code-breaker and early computer scientist Alan Turing.

LONDON – Matthew Goode (Stoker), Mark Strong (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y) and Rory Kinnear (Skyfall) have joined Benedict Cumberbatch and Keira Knightley in indie movie drama The Imitation Game.

Charles Dance (Gosford Park), Allen Leech (In Fear, TV’s Downton Abbey) and Matthew Beard (An Education) will also turn out for the movie, directed by Norwegian filmmaker Morten Tyldum (Headhunters) from a screenplay by Graham Moore, based on the book Alan Turing: The Enigma by Andrew Hodges.

Turing (Cumberbatch) was a U.K. mathematician and cryptographer who helped crack the German enigma code during the final years of World War II, helping the Allies to victory. He was later prosecuted by the government for being a homosexual and committed suicide.

Black Bear Pictures’ Teddy Schwarzman is producing alongside Nora Grossman and Ido Ostrowsky, with Moore as executive producer and Peter Heslop (The King’s Speech) as co-producer.

Starz to Air BBC Period Drama ‘Dancing on the Edge’

The 1930s jazz-centric series, starring Chiwetel Ejiofor, Matthew Goode and John Goodman, will get a stateside bow in October.

Starz has landed the U.S. rights to Dancing on the Edge. The period drama comes from playwright Stephen Poliakoff and saw its official premiere on BBC2 earlier in year.

Starring Chiwetel Ejiofor, Matthew Goode, John Goodman, Angel Coulby, Anthony Head and Jacqueline Bisset, Dancing on the Edge chronicles The Louis Lester Band, an all-black jazz ensemble playing the club circuit in 1930s London. The series chronicles the band’s rise to fame while dealing while racist resistance among the city’s aristocrats and, ultimately, a murder mystery.

Billed as a five-episode miniseries, Dancing on the Edge bows on Starz in October. It joins another import, BBC One co-production The White Queen, which comes to the network in August.

Watch Out for…

Benedict Cumberbatch and Matthew Goode, who will star in the film The Imitation Game. Keira Knightley is in negotiations to play the female lead but hasn’t signed yet. 

Cumberbatch will portray Alan Turing, the mathematical genius who helped to crack the Germans’ Enigma code, with Goode as fellow code-breaker Hugh Alexander.

The role earmarked for Keira is that of Joan  Clarke, who was also part of the top-secret team at Bletchley Park.

Graham Moore’s script is based on Andrew Hodges’s book about Turing, and explores how he told Clarke of his homosexuality — but she still wanted to marry him (they never did).

It also tells of how Turing was prosecuted for what were then illegal sex acts and no one came to help  him during a humiliating court case.
